About Ipsen:

Ipsen is a mid-sized global biopharmaceutical company with a focus on transformative medicines in three therapeutic areas: Oncology, Rare Disease and Neuroscience. Supported by nearly 100 years of development experience, with global hubs in the U.S., France and the U.K, we tackle areas of high unmet medical need through research and innovation.

Our passionate teams in more than 40 countries are focused on what matters and endeavor every day to bring medicines to patients in 88 countries. Job Description:

The Head of Global Regulatory Operations provides enterprise leadership for Regulatory Operations across Global Regulatory Affairs (GRA), defining the long-term vision, operating model and capabilities required to enable Ipsen's global regulatory strategy. The role is accountable for ensuring world-class regulatory operations through excellence in regulatory data, digital platforms, submissions, labelling governance and operational execution.

As a member of the Global Regulatory Affairs Leadership Team, the VP partners across R&D, Quality, Medical, IT and Commercial functions to drive enterprise transformation, accelerate regulatory delivery and strengthen Ipsen's competitive advantage through innovation, digitalization and operational excellence.

The role is accountable for:

  • Defining and executing the Global Regulatory Operations strategy aligned with Ipsen's corporate and R&D objectives.
  • Leading the transformation of Regulatory Operations through digital innovation, AI, automation and data-driven decision making.
  • Building a high-performing global organization that delivers operational excellence, inspection readiness and sustainable business performance.
  • Providing enterprise governance for regulatory systems, regulatory data, submission management and global labelling.
  • Driving a culture of collaboration, accountability, innovation and continuous improvement.

Main Responsibilities & Technical Competencies

Enterprise Leadership & Strategy:

  • Define the strategic direction, operating model and long-term capability roadmap for Global Regulatory Operations, ensuring alignment with Global Regulatory Affairs, R&D strategy and future business priorities.
  • Lead a global leadership team, building organizational capability, succession plans and an inclusive, high-performing culture.
  • Represent Regulatory Operations within executive governance forums and influence enterprise decision-making.

Operational Excellence:

  • Own enterprise performance across Regulatory Operations including regulatory data governance, publishing, submissions, labelling, regulatory systems and operational delivery.
  • Establish KPIs, governance and performance dashboards to continuously improve quality, compliance, productivity and customer experience.
  • Ensure inspection readiness and sustainable compliance with evolving global regulatory requirements.

Digital Transformation:

  • Define and deliver the digital transformation strategy for Regulatory Operations, leveraging AI, automation, structured content management and emerging technologies to improve efficiency, scalability and regulatory effectiveness.
  • Partner with Digital & IT to modernize platforms, strengthen data governance and develop future-ready regulatory capabilities.

Labelling (CCDS, USPI and SmPC):

  • Lead global labelling governance ensuring consistency and compliance; implement digital tools for labelling lifecycle management; explore AI-driven solutions for signal detection and automated updates.

Regulatory Project Management:

  • Provide strategic oversight for major submissions and regulatory milestones
  • Develop project dashboards and predictive analytics for risk management
  • Champion agile methodologies for faster delivery under submission, excellence
  • Own and improve Submission Excellence process & playbook, support IND Excellence project

Compliance:

  • Support inspection readiness for audits of Global Regulatory Affairs
  • Organizes and ensures compliance to global standards & laws applicable to Global Regulatory Affairs, ensuring all systems are in compliance with GRA requirements.

Enterprise Governance:

  • Establish enterprise governance for regulatory operations, ensuring clear decision-making, accountability, risk management and cross-functional alignment.
  • Sponsor business process harmonization and continuous improvement initiatives across the regulatory value chain.

External Leadership:

  • Build strategic partnerships with Health Authorities, industry associations, technology vendors and external partners to position Ipsen at the forefront of Regulatory Operations innovation.

Financial & Resource Management:

  • Own the Global Regulatory Operations budget, vendor strategy and investment roadmap.
  • Optimize organizational resources and external partnerships to deliver sustainable operational performance.

Knowledge & Experience

Knowledge & Experience (essential):

  • Executive leadership experience within Research & Development in a complex, global biopharmaceutical organization.
  • Proven experience developing and executing global operational strategies that support business growth and regulatory excellence.
  • Demonstrated leadership of large global, geographically dispersed organisations through significant transformation and organisational change.
  • Deep expertise across regulatory submissions, regulatory data, publishing, labelling, regulatory information management and digital technologies.
  • Strong executive stakeholder management with demonstrated ability to influence senior leaders across R&D, Quality, Medical, Commercial and Digital.
  • Proven experience leading enterprise digital transformation, automation and AI-enabled initiatives.
  • Experience managing significant operational budgets, strategic vendors and outsourced partnerships.
  • Demonstrated ability to build inclusive, high-performing organisations and develop future leadership capability.
